This is a simple motor mount designed for a Lidl glider modified as a flying wing by chopping the tail off. It glues on to the back of the fuselage where I cut mine just past the wing. There are about 3 degrees of downthrust built in to the motor mount which my aircraft appears to need to stop it climbing every time I throttle up. Feel free to alter the files found here;

If you want more or less down thrust.
Any 16/19mm M3 bolt hole pattern brushless motor should fit on to this motor mount.
I would recommend taping over the back of the fuselage where you cut it short, then you can use hot glue to attach the motor mount to the taped surface. This allows you to more easily remove the motor mount later (especially if you don't go crazy with the hot glue) without tearing up the foam.
